自定义指标·RSI背离信号

CN
5 小時前

RSI指标,全称为「相对强弱指标」,是技术分析中广泛使用的工具。它通过分析价格的涨跌幅度,帮助投资者判断市场趋势及潜在反转信号。当RSI出现背离时,通常会引起市场关注。那么,什么是RSI背离信号?它背后的原因是什么?对于技术分析又意味着什么?接下来我们将逐一展开。

自定义指标·RSI背离信号_aicoin_图1

一、原因分析:为什么会出现RSI背离

RSI背离通常源于价格走势与动能之间的不同步,以下是它可能出现的几种原因:

1.趋势力度与动能的偏差

a.在上涨趋势中,价格屡创新高,但RSI指标未能同步创新高,出现「顶部背离」。

b.在下跌趋势中,价格不断创新低,但RSI未创新低,形成「底部背离」。这暗示市场动能或许正在转弱,可能预示趋势反转。

2.市场情绪的变化

a.市场情绪发生转变(例如过度乐观或悲观),导致价格未必完全反映真实价值,也可能促成RSI指标出现背离。

3.主力操控的可能性

​​​​​​​a.主力资金通过制造价格走势假象,误导投资者情绪,从而引发RSI背离信号。

二、技术分析中的RSI背离意义

RSI背离不仅是价格反转前的预警信号,同时也是重要的分析工具,对投资决策有以下几层意义:

1.顶部背离与底部背离的启示

顶部背离:提示投资者需警惕上涨趋势中的风险,谨防市场下行。
底部背离:提醒投资者关注可能的反转机会,有助于寻找潜在的买入时机。

2.提高交易决策的准确性

RSI背离结合其他技术指标(如MACD、均线等),可帮助投资者建立多维度分析体系,从而降低交易风险、提高策略有效性。

3.助力趋势反转的判断能力

虽然RSI背离无法百分百预测市场变化,但它可为投资者提供参考,并补充短期反转预判的依据。

三、顶部背离与底部背离的对比一览

以下表格详细展示了两种RSI背离类型间的区别:

自定义指标·RSI背离信号_aicoin_图2

温馨提示: RSI背离信号并非绝对精准,投资者在分析市场时应结合多种工具(如技术指标与基本面分析),综合判断市场走势,以作出更明智的交易决策。

四、自定义指标 · RSI背离信号效果

自定义指标·RSI背离信号_aicoin_图3​​​​​​​

(图:OKX-BTCUSDT 永续合约 1日 周期)

自定义指标·RSI背离信号_aicoin_图4
(图: OKX-ETHUSDT 永续合约 1日 周期)

五、自定义指标 · 脚本源码

// @version=2
// 在这里创建您的自定义脚本
// 背离检查使用的K线数量
divergence_check_len = 100
// 顶背离监控
func_bearish_divergence(src, value) {
    maybe_second_peak = value < value[1] and value[1] > value[2]
    if (not maybe_second_peak) {
        rets = [nan, nan, false]
        return false
    }
    var peak1_idx = 0;
    var peak2_idx = 0;
    
    for (i=0; i<divergence_check_len; i++) {
        if (value[i] < value[i+1] and value[i+1] > value[i+2]) {
            if (value[i+1] > value[peak2_idx]) {
                if (value[i+1] > value[peak1_idx]) {
                    peak2_idx := peak1_idx
                    peak1_idx := i+1
                } else {
                    peak2_idx := i+1
                }
            }
        }
    }
    if peak1_idx == peak2_idx {
        rets = [nan, nan, false]
        return false
    }
    src_peak1 = src[peak1_idx]
    src_peak2 = src[peak2_idx]
    value_peak1 = value[peak1_idx]
    value_peak2 = value[peak2_idx]
    result = src_peak1 < src_peak2 and value_peak1 > value_peak2 and peak2_idx == 1
    // rets = [peak1_idx, peak2_idx, result]
    return result
}
// 底背离监控
func_bullish_divergence(src, value) {
    maybe_second_peak = value > value[1] and value[1] < value[2]
    if (not maybe_second_peak) {
        rets = [nan, nan, false]
        return false
    }
    var peak1_idx = 0;
    var peak2_idx = 0;
    
    for (i=0; i<divergence_check_len; i++) {
        if (value[i] > value[i+1] and value[i+1] < value[i+2]) {
            if (value[i+1] < value[peak2_idx]) {
                if (value[i+1] < value[peak1_idx]) {
                    peak2_idx := peak1_idx
                    peak1_idx := i+1
                } else {
                    peak2_idx := i+1
                }
            }
        }
    }
    if peak1_idx == peak2_idx {
        rets = [nan, nan, false]
        return false
    }
    src_peak1 = src[peak1_idx]
    src_peak2 = src[peak2_idx]
    value_peak1 = value[peak1_idx]
    value_peak2 = value[peak2_idx]
    result = src_peak1 > src_peak2 and value_peak1 < value_peak2 and peak2_idx == 1
    // rets = [peak1_idx, peak2_idx, result]
    return result
}
rsi12 = rsi(close, 12);
is_breaish_divergence = func_bearish_divergence(close, rsi12)
plotText(is_breaish_divergence, title='顶背离', text='顶背离', refSeries=high, bgColor='red', color='white', fontSize=14, placement='top', display=true);
is_bullish_divergence = func_bullish_divergence(close, rsi12)
plotText(is_bullish_divergence, title='底背离', text='底背离', refSeries=low, bgColor='green', color='white', fontSize=14, placement='bottom', display=true);


 六、总结与启发

适用场景建议

RSI指标最适合应用于单边行情或趋势明显的市场环境,可有效辅助投资者预判市场的趋势状态以及潜在的反转信号。

对于走势缓慢或震荡区间的行情,建议将RSI与其他技术指标(如MACD、均线或支撑阻力位)结合使用,加以验证与调整,以提升准确性。尤其在短线交易和趋势反转判断上,RSI背离信号非常具有价值,但需避免在震荡行情中使用单一指标作出错误决策。

风险管理建议

不建议在无明显趋势的震荡区间内,单独依赖RSI背离信号进行频繁交易;可以通过观察信号的时间级别,区分可能的强信号与弱信号,规避小幅反转或假动作导致的追涨杀跌。

执行交易时应严格设置止损点位,保持资金分配比例得当,如建议仓位控制在5%-10%,以尽量减少市场波动对账户带来的潜在风险。

综上

从实际交易效果来看,RSI指标在趋势反转的预判中具备一定的可靠性,尤其是底背离能够有效提示可能的上涨机会,而顶背离信号通常适合用于警惕市场下行风险。但在震荡市场或趋势不明朗时,若单独依赖RSI指标,可能导致撤回率或信号精准性下降。因此,建议结合其他技术分析工具使用,例如MACD、均线或基本面研究,以进一步提高交易胜率和决策鲁棒性。

加入我们的社区,一起来讨论,一起变得更强吧!

官方电报(Telegram)社群:t.me/aicoincn

AiCoin中文推特:https://x.com/AiCoinzh

群聊 - 致富群:

https://www.aicoin.com/link/chat?cid=10013

免责声明:本文章仅代表作者个人观点,不代表本平台的立场和观点。本文章仅供信息分享,不构成对任何人的任何投资建议。用户与作者之间的任何争议,与本平台无关。如网页中刊载的文章或图片涉及侵权,请提供相关的权利证明和身份证明发送邮件到support@aicoin.com,本平台相关工作人员将会进行核查。

分享至:
APP下載

X

Telegram

Facebook

Reddit

複製鏈接